There is deep concern over air quality in China especially during the 2008 Olympics held there. Concern was raised over the air quality, and its potential effect on the athletes. Beijing committed then to remove 60,000 taxis and buses from the roads by the end of 2007 and relocate 200 local factories, including a prominent steel factory, China’s Olympian attempt
Tag: